Redruth Rugby match news

Cambridge 52 Redruth 5

Headlines, Match Reports / Sunday 3 April 2011

Match report by Ed Bawden

Cambridge gave Redruth a lesson in running rugby as they touched down 8 tries to inflict the Reds’ biggest defeat for 5 years.

Cambridge played a fast attractive game but Redruth were competitive for the first 25 minutes until Owen Hambly was sin binned for killing the ball near the line.

In a devastating 10 minute spell Cambridge made the man advantage tell as they ran in three converted tries and the game was over as a contest.

Redruth had the better of the scrummaging, Steve Wood worked tremendously hard while Matt Bowden back in the side after injury had a decent game.

In good conditions Redruth opened well: Brett Rule was just wide with a penalty into the wind in the 4th minute. Rule wore the number 10 shirt after Aaron Penberthy was called up to play for the South West under 20’s.

In the centre for the hosts Phil Ellis was a powerhouse and his running tormented the Reds all afternoon and he ran in the first two tries both of which former Ivybridge College fly half Dan Mugford converted.

From the restart a Redruth mistake allowed Billy Robinson to run in a try which Ben Spencer converted, Cambridge had the bonus point in the bag just before the interval when Will Martin ran in a good try that Spencer converted to leave the Reds 28 points behind at half time.

In the 3rd quarter the Cornishmen were very competitive and Hambly looked to be over for a try following good play by Mark Bright but the final pass was forward.

Robinson got his second try from more scintillating Cambridge play in the 59th minute.

Falmouth University student Chris Bailey – originally from Hereford – came on in the Reds’ second row and made a good impression on his debut.

Martin got a second try after 69 minutes and skipper Darren Fox went over to loud cheers from a big crowd for a try that Martin converted. Robinson completed his hattrick just before the end Martin adding two conversions.

The Reds best bit of play in injury time following a solid scrum saw Rule put Bowden away on the half way line with a subtle dummy. The Reds’ full back raced over to touchdown in the right hand corner for an unconverted try.
